Dutch Gaming Authority reports 25 cases of footballers betting on own games
At least 25 football players in the Netherlands have been found to have placed bets on matches in which they have played in themselves, or on matches in their own league. The news became apparent from a document from the Gaming Authority that is in the hands of the NOS, while the players were reportedly from the Eredivisie and Kitchen …

Star Wars Battlefront II was released this week, and with it came further questions surrounding the game’s use of virtual ‘loot boxes’. The game, created by California-based video gaming giants Electronic Arts (EA), has drew criticism for implementing these add-on boxes that must be purchased with real-life cash, and is now under investigation from the Belgian Gaming Commission.
